Brisbane: Mohammed Siraj’s beautifully impressive 5-wicket haul was heartwarming to see as Mohammed Siraj lead Team India with a 5-wicket haul in the last innings of his first-ever Test series. Siraj finished with figures of 5/73 on Day 4 of the 4th test at the Gabba in Brisbane.

Mohammed Siraj has become only the 5th Indian bowler to pick up a 5-wicket haul at the Gabba. He joined an elite list of bowlers Erapalli Prasanna, Bishan Singh Bedi, Madan Lal and Zaheer Khan. Siraj also has the 3rd best figures for an Indian in Brisbane.

Mohammed Siraj, has topped the list of bowlers with most wickets for India in the ongoing Border-Gavaskar series. Siraj has finished with 13 wickets from 3 matches, 1 more than Ravichandran Ashwin, who was not available for the 4th Test due to a back injury.
